Agent guide: [/agents.md](https://www.wearedevelopers.com/agents.md). --- # Data & AI Solutions Architect - **Company:** Orangepeople LLC - **Location:** Plano, TX, United States - **Experience:** Expert - **Salary:** $125,685.0 - $174,562.0 - **Contract:** Permanent contract - **Skills:** Artificial Intelligence, Amazon Web Services, Data Analysis, Cloud Database, Data Architecture, Data Discovery, Information Engineering, Data Governance, Data Infrastructure, Supervisory Control and Data Acquisition (SCADA), Python (Programming Language), SAP (Applications), Software Deployment, SQL Databases, Enterprise Application Integration, Data Ingestion, Snowflake, Data Lakes, Wikis, Data Management, Amazon Redshift, Databricks - **Published:** August 23, 2026 - **Apply:** https://www.careerjet.com/jobad/usd24baccbb30bee809bcb3bc375fac307 ## About the Role We are seeking a highly experienced Data & AI Solutions Architect to support a strategic enterprise initiative focused on identifying, evaluating, and enabling data- and AI-driven solutions within a manufacturing environment. This role is not a traditional delivery-focused data engineering position. The successful candidate must be comfortable operating in an evolving and ambiguous environment where business requirements, use cases, and platform capabilities are still being defined. The ideal candidate will bring a blend of technical expertise, architectural thinking, business acumen, and strong stakeholder engagement skills. They will work closely with business leaders, architects, engineers, and manufacturing stakeholders to identify high-value opportunities, define solution approaches, create conceptual architectures, and guide future implementation efforts., * 8+ years of experience in Data Engineering, Data Architecture, Analytics Architecture, or related roles. * Strong experience with SQL and Python. * Experience designing enterprise-scale data platforms and data architectures. * Proven ability to operate successfully in ambiguous, early-stage programs. * Experience leading discovery and requirements gathering efforts. * Demonstrated ability to translate business challenges into technical solutions. * Experience creating solution architectures, technical roadmaps, and implementation strategies. * Strong understanding of data modeling, data governance, and enterprise integration patterns. * Experience supporting cloud-based data ecosystems (AWS preferred). * Excellent communication and stakeholder management skills. * Ability to work independently with minimal supervision. Preferred Qualifications: * Experience supporting AI, Advanced Analytics, or Digital Transformation programs. * Experience developing AI and Generative AI use cases. * Experience with Databricks, Snowflake, Redshift, or similar modern data platforms. * Experience with Industrial IoT, manufacturing systems, MES, ERP, SCADA, or telemetry platforms. * Experience with proof-of-concept planning and execution. * Experience presenting to executive leadership and steering committees. * Background in automotive, battery manufacturing, or industrial environments., * Strong strategic thinking and business curiosity. * Ability to thrive in highly ambiguous environments. * Self-directed and proactive work style. * Comfort defining solutions before requirements are fully known. * Ability to independently research business processes and identify opportunities. * Confidence challenging assumptions and proposing new approaches. * Strong facilitation and stakeholder engagement capabilities. * Balance between architecture, strategy, and hands-on technical execution. ## Description * Discovery & Strategy * Lead data discovery activities across manufacturing and enterprise business domains. * Collaborate with business stakeholders to understand operational challenges, opportunities, and objectives. * Identify, evaluate, and prioritize AI, analytics, and digital transformation use cases. * Translate business needs into technical solution concepts and implementation roadmaps. * Drive requirements gathering, stakeholder interviews, and workshop sessions. * Architecture & Solution Design * Design conceptual and logical data architectures supporting AI and analytics initiatives. * Assess existing enterprise data ecosystems and identify integration opportunities. * Define data requirements, source system dependencies, and solution approaches. * Create architecture recommendations, proof-of-concept strategies, and technical roadmaps. * Collaborate with enterprise architecture, application, and platform teams. * Data Engineering Leadership * Design and support scalable data ingestion, transformation, and processing frameworks. * Define data modeling strategies for operational, analytical, and AI consumption. * Support architecture decisions involving cloud platforms, data lakes, and enterprise data hubs. * Provide technical guidance for future implementation and production deployment activities. * Cross-Functional Collaboration * Act as a trusted advisor across business and technical teams. * Facilitate discussions between manufacturing, operations, engineering, and IT stakeholders. * Present findings, recommendations, and progress updates to leadership and steering committees. * Guide teams through ambiguity and help establish strategic direction., * Participate in OP monthly team meetings and participate in team-building efforts. * Contribute to OP technical discussions, peer reviews, etc. * Contribute content and collaborate via the OP-Wiki/Knowledge Base. * Provide status reports to OP Account Management as requested. ## Related Videos -
